Output 66f33cba95bdb0224a07d96a32b743e6b8629203356a8288b4130edb8789ae3e:42

value
475506
script pubkey
OP_0 OP_PUSHBYTES_20 29f073554c11226a4852ae7d7e58ac2735405f69
address
bc1q98c8x42vzy3x5jzj4e7huk9vyu65qhmfrcfgg5
transaction
66f33cba95bdb0224a07d96a32b743e6b8629203356a8288b4130edb8789ae3e
spent
true